Use Spatial Join Tool Spatial Join—Help | ArcGIS Desktop , to know what each point fill inside which polygon . you will get that with attached attribute.
Then Use Summary Statistics tool Summary Statistics—Help | ArcGIS Desktop using the attached field that relate to polygon name or number.and make your statistics analysis for.

I have points for all polygons.
I want to do thease calculations and add the results to each polygon so that you easly can use the "info" tool to get this:
Area - This is alredy in the polygon.
Sum of points within each polygon
Sum of points within each polygon / (devided) by Area
Mean value of points within each polygon
Avrage spacing of points: √10000/(Sum of points within each polygon / (devided) by Area)
Not easy to understand how to really do this, peferly I would like to use modelbuilder so i can add this to the other analasys where i got this data from.
In this case the polygon feature only has unike field value in "OBJECTID", after spatial join "OBJECTID_1".
OK, to answer myself.
First of all Abdullah Anter was right.
To do what I wanted I needed to understand how Join and Relate really works.
Then just add fields and calculate them in modelbuilder as desired.
1. Join by spatial reference
2. Statistics based on a comon field attribute ex. "ObjectID" to get them to correspond to eachother.
3. Join Field from the statistics to the polygon.
4. Then add fields an do the nesseserry calculations.
